Troy Neal Orange was born February 2, 1949, in Kilgore, Texas, to the parentage of John Wesley Orange Sr. and Jewel Woods Orange.
At a young age, Troy accepted Christ at Harmony Pirtle Baptist Church. He attended C.B. Dansby School to the 11th grade. While attending school he would work alongside his father at his BBQ Shop. Then later exploring many skill sets with his atypical persona. Troy, was hard working, a well-known respected-hustler and family loving man. He gave his last and lended his hand to many. He enjoyed fishing, playing cards and dominoes, rooting for the NY Giants and a “good” T-bone steak. Most of all, spending time with loved ones.
